TASTING NOTES FOR Hope Estate Signature Shiraz Hunter Valley New South Wales 2014
🍷 Appearance
Deep ruby to garnet with a rich, concentrated core, showing maturity and depth in the glass.
👃 Aromas
Intense and layered, revealing blackberry, plum and cassis with notes of vanilla, cedar and spice from oak maturation. Subtle earthy and savoury tones have developed with age, adding complexity.
👅 Palate
Medium to full-bodied and richly flavoured, delivering concentrated dark fruit including plum and berry compote. Balanced acidity provides freshness, while integrated oak brings notes of mocha, spice and vanilla.
🍈 Texture & Finish
Plush and rounded with well-integrated tannins providing structure and longevity. The finish is long and persistent, with lingering dark fruit, spice and savoury oak nuances.
🍇 Overall Style
A classic Hunter Valley Shiraz—rich, structured and evolving beautifully with age. Combines ripe fruit intensity with savoury complexity and oak integration, offering both immediate enjoyment and further cellaring potential.
🍽️ Food Pairing
Perfect with grilled steak, roast lamb, slow-cooked beef or hearty dishes. Also excellent with aged cheeses and rich, savoury meals.
